We are recruiting聽postdoctoral researcher for a fixed term contract between 1.9.2026-31.8.2028 for the Research Council of Finland funded Academy Research Fellow project聽Metaphysics, Ethics, and Epistemology of Risk. Starting date is flexible, but the end date is set. Project Risk judgments play a pivotal role in human societies. By acting in the world we inevitably take聽risks and impose them on others.聽Risk聽is connected to normative practices. For instance, whether a war against a state suspected of sponsoring terrorism is聽morally justified聽depends in part on whether it minimizes the聽risk聽of future terrorist attacks. It is often proper to聽blame聽someone for imposing unnecessary聽risks on us, such as transporting hazardous materials without taking proper safety measures. Plausibly, whether one聽knows聽a proposition depends on how high the聽risk聽of forming a false belief is. But what exactly is risk, and why is it of normative significance? In the research project 鈥楳etaphysics, Ethics, and Epistemology of Risk鈥 new insights about how we should understand risk are applied to a wide range of ethical and epistemological questions. The postdoctoral researcher鈥檚 work is expected to focus on epistemological questions where the notion of risk can be utilized, such as 鈥榗an knowledge be understood in terms of risk?鈥, 鈥榓re closure principles compatible with an anti-risk conception of knowledge and justification?鈥, 鈥榳hat kind of structural properties does an anti-risk epistemology predict for knowledge?鈥, 鈥榙o iterations of knowledge accumulate risk?鈥, 鈥榮hould disinformation be understood as information that incurs epistemic risks on others?鈥, 鈥榳hat is the connection between risk and certainty?鈥, and 鈥榳hat kind of insight does anti-risk epistemology have regarding pragmatic encroachment?鈥. In addition to the to be hired postdoctoral researcher the project team consists of the PI (Jaakko Hirvel盲), whose work focuses on the metaphysics and epistemology of risk, and a postdoctoral researcher (Oskari Sivula) who works on ethical questions related to risk. The project runs in tandem with another research project on risk (鈥楾he Structure and Nature of Risk鈥, PI Jaakko Hirvel盲), which houses an additional postdoctoral researcher (Pablo Zendejas Medina) working on the philosophy of risk. The project team will conduct research into the nature of risk, and apply philosophical theories of risk to epistemological and ethical issues. The primary methods of the research project are philosophical analysis and model-building. What we offer The salary for the position will be based on level 5 of the job requirement scheme for teaching and research personnel in the salary system of Finnish universities. In addition, the appointee will be paid a salary component based on personal performance. The annual gross salary is 鈧42,000 - 鈧49,000. In Finnish universities, the teaching and research staff (app. 65% of total staff) have a special system regarding the free time equivalent to holiday. They belong to the 1,612 annual working hour system, in which the annual amount of paid holiday is app. 5-6 weeks on average per year.
